    About 10 days ago i “agreed” to have a bike, and went off to sort my cycle work voucher, no deposit paid or anything like that, the LBS do price match but not on the initial voucher amount as i think they lose 10% anyway…. my quandry is that i have now discovered the general countrywide price online has dropped dramatically by £350! what do i do? surely they cant expect me to happily cough up an extra £350 more than i can get the bike for elsewhere? I would gladly pay an extra 10% to cover the loss on the cycle scheme, do i ask for the discount or pull out if they ask me to pay the extra?

    I was in a similar quandry
    I was in a similar quandry with my cycle scheme voucher – places often stick the price up when they know you have a voucher – in the end I bought online (with an online discount voucher) so withdrew from the cycle scheme voucher as I got a great deal online that matched a retail shop using the cycle scheme voucher but without the conditions attached to the scheme – if you want to get it from a lbs though, I would push for the price match or get it from another lbs!
